Te Wahi is the product of two contrasting vineyards in New Zealand's dramatic Central Otago region. Rocky Northburn yields grapes of great structure and intensity, while the softer terrain of Calvert produces scented, opulent fruit.
These complementary vineyards work together to deliver a beautifully balanced wine. Dark, intense and elegant, combining concentrated tannins with a crisp vibrancy, it captures all that is essential about this area’s pinot noir.

TASTING NOTES:
Wild, fresh and fruity

Aroma

Dusky brambles, wild strawberries and hints of violet.

Taste

The palate abounds with damson and hedgerow fruit. Dense tannins and vibrant freshness bring tension, balance and clarity, drawing to a long and focused finish.

BLEND AND ORIGIN:
Cloudy Bay Te Wahi 2018

A hot, abnormally still spring in Central Otago was followed by a sizzling summer, then cooler conditions and rain.
 

The 2018 harvest was brought in early with the fruit in beautiful condition, and predominantly de-stemmed into open-top fermenters with 22% whole-bunch inclusion.
 

After soaking and fermentation, the grapes were aged for 12 months in French oak barriques.
